Board of DirectorsMr. Golombek is Managing Director, Tax and Estate Planning with CIBC Private Wealth Management. His work involves both internal and external consulting on all areas of taxation and estate planning. Prior to joining CIBC in July 2008, Mr. Golombek was Vice-President, Tax and Estate Planning with Invesco Trimark Investments. Prior to joining Invesco Trimark in July 1996, Mr. Golombek was a tax specialist in the Toronto office of Deloitte & Touche LLP, where he specialized in both personal and corporate tax planning. Jamie is quoted frequently in the national media as an expert on taxation, writes a weekly column called “Tax Expert” in the National Post, has appeared as a guest on CBC Newsworld and The National and is a regular columnist for both Advocis’ FORUM magazine, a trade journal for financial advisors, as well as Advisor’s Edge Report. Mr. Golombek received his B.Com. from McGill University, earned his Chartered Accountant designation in Ontario and qualified as a U.S. Certified Public Accountant in the State of Illinois. Mr. Golombek has also obtained his Certified Financial Planning (CFP) and Chartered Life Underwriting (CLU) designations. In September 2006, Mr. Golombek was awarded the Institute of Chartered Accountants of Ontario’s Award of Distinction, which honours those CAs who have made an early impact, bringing distinction to themselves and to their profession through leadership and achievement in their professional, community and/or personal lives. Mr. Golombek is the past chair of the Investment Funds Institute of Canada’s Tax Working Group as well as a member of the Ontario Institute of Chartered Accountants, the Illinois CPA Society, the Estate Planning Council of Toronto, the Canadian Tax Foundation and the Society of Trust and Estate Practitioners. Mr. Golombek also teaches an MBA course in Personal Finance at the Schulich School of Business at York University in Toronto. |
